The Newfoundland Mummers' play makes unannounced house visits in and around St. John's during the twelve days of Christmas. This school group is directed by original Mummers Troupe member Lynn Lunde.
In winter, the Bedford Morris Men perform a traditional Plough Play. Their script comes from Branston, Leicestershire, collected by Davd Welti, a former squire of Bedford Morris and the Morris Ring.
The group performs at pubs etc around Bedfordshire during December, collections are for charity. Traditional performances on Boxing Day (outside The George, Silsoe approx 12.30pm) and on Plough Monday (Cross Key, Pulloxhill approx 9.00pm).
Cold Ash mummers were formed after mummers featured in a village play. The play's author, Richard Marshall, founded the Mummers afterwards based on the remembered fragments of the original Cold Ash play. Over the years we have developed our own distinctive style and tradition.
